126. To ask the Minister for Justice and Equality the number of inquests which Ministers have ordered under section 23 of the Coroners Act 1962 since the introduction of that legislation; and the jurisdictions these inquests were held in. [15874/16]
Jonathan O'Brien (Cork North Central, Sinn Fein)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source
135. To ask the Minister for Justice and Equality the number of inquests that have been held into the deaths of persons whose bodies were not recovered, since the enactment of the Coroners Act 1962; and the time which elapsed between the person being reported missing and the inquest being held, by case. [16018/16]
Frances Fitzgerald (Dublin Mid West, Fine Gael)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source
I propose to take Questions Nos. 126 and 135 together.
The data which is immediately to hand dates back to 1999 and is tabulated beneath. It relates to the number of inquests directed by the Minister for Justice and Equality under the provisions of Section 23 of the Coroners Act, 1962. The data requested by the Deputy for the years 1962 to 1998 is not readily available. Nonetheless, my officials will seek to collate this information and provide to you in due course.
Year | Total Number of Section 23 Directions | Coronial District |
---|---|---|
1999 | 6 | Donegal North East Limerick West Cork South Cork West Wexford South Kerry West |
2000 | 3 | Cork West |
2001 | 4 | Mayo South Clare Donegal North East Cork South |
2002 | 5 | Dublin County Galway West (2) Limerick West Cork West |
2003 | 2 | Donegal North West Wicklow East |
2004 | 0 | --- |
2005 | 2 | Cork West Wicklow East |
2006 | 0 | --- |
2007 | 8 | Waterford West (3) Wexford South (3) Wicklow East Kerry South East |
2008 | 2 | Clare Donegal South West |
2009 | 4 | Dublin City (3) Kerry North |
2010 | 9 | Clare (4) Cork West (3) Cork City Mayo North |
2011 | 4 | Clare Wexford North Cork South Dublin |
2012 | 4 | Clare Cork South Wicklow East Dublin |
2013 | 7 | Dublin (4) Clare Cork South Mayo North |
2014 | 4 | Clare Wexford (2) Cork South |
2015 | 2 | Waterford East Kerry South East |
2016 (to 14 June 2016) | 2 | Limerick Clare |
As the Deputy is aware, the legislation governing Coroners is the Coroners Act, 1962. Under this legislation a Coroner is a statutory officer exercising quasi-judicial functions, in relation to which he or she is independent. You will appreciate that neither I nor my Department has any role in the scheduling of individual inquests. The retention of Coroners' records is a matter for each individual Coroner and the County Registrar for the Coroner's local authority district under Section 29 of the Coroners Act 1962.
